On 10/18/2017 12:48 AM, Gerd Hoffmann wrote:
> Hi,
>
>> +if [ "$capstone_internal" = "yes" ]; then
>> + echo "config-host.h: subdir-capstone" >> $config_host_mak
>> +fi
>
> I think this isn't going to work correctly. In case both capstone and
> dtc are used we need a single line with the dependencies, i.e.
>
> config-host.h: subdir-dtc subdir-capstone
Make allows the composition of dependencies, as in:
a: b
a: c
It works as long as at most one a: line contains the rule for building
a, and all the other lines just add dependencies.

On Tue, Oct 17, 2017 at 08:37:42AM -0700, Richard Henderson wrote:
> Do not require the submodule, but use it if present (in preference
> even to a system copy). This will allow us to easily use capstone
> in older systems for which a package is not available, and also
> easily track bug fixes from upstream.
I don't like the idea that we should blindly use the submodule
even if the host OS has it installed. This means developers working
on git will never be testing against the capstone that will actually
be used when they deploy a release build on their distro.
It also gives inconsistent behaviour wrt the way the dtc module
is handled, where we always try to use the system version and
only try the submodule if the system version is missing.
Thus I think we really ought to deal with capstone in the same
way as dtc. We could make the check a little more advanced so that
it checks for the particular capstone feature QEMU wants. That way
if someone does have an outdated capstone we'd still use the submodule.
